**Vendor note: Inkmill markdown pipeline**

Rendering for Parchway docs is outsourced to Inkmill under an annual contract, renewing each March. They handle sanitization and PDF export; we own the upload queue. SLA: 4-hour response on rendering failures. Escalate only after two failed retries. Their support desk is reachable at the address below.

billing contact of hahaf-baguf = zorael.tammir.jorius@sivrelhq.internal

Quarterly Planning Note — Divestiture of the Coastal Tooling Unit

For the finance team: the sale of the Coastal Tooling unit to Pellmark Industries remains on track for close in Q3. Please finalize the carve-out balance sheet, reconcile intercompany positions, and prepare the working-capital adjustment schedule by month-end. Audit support requests should be prioritized. For planning purposes, note the following sensitive item:

internal memo for hawef-kahif: The finance team signed off on a budget of $25.9 million for Project Sorox. The renewal with Pelokek Logistics closes at $51.7 million a year, 52 percent below the last contract.

Quarterly Planning Note — Project Lanternwell Delay

Welcome aboard! Quick context before your first planning cycle: Lanternwell, our internal billing-platform rebuild, is now two quarters behind. The old team underestimated the data migration, and we lost our lead engineer to the Farrowgate rollout. Current plan: descope the reporting module, ship core billing by Q3, and backfill two developer roles. Budget impact is around 15% over original. Nothing dramatic, but it needs steady hands. How this fits the bigger picture is noted below.

board note of baweg-bawig: Project Tamath slips by six weeks because of the audit delay.

Handing over the Quillbrook partner SFTP drop. Their nightly feed lands between 02:00 and 03:30 in the inbound bucket, and the Ferrowise ingest job picks it up at 04:00. If the file is missing, wait until 05:00 before escalating — their side retries twice. Checksums are in a sidecar file; the ingest job rejects mismatches and parks them in quarantine, where they sit for seven days. Rotation of the drop credentials happens quarterly. The monitoring dashboard and escalation contacts are documented on the page below.

dashboard of bafof-hafog = https://confluence.lumiclabs.internal/display/browse/display/6a09a20a